Snapshot testing in the Pixelgate component suite is subject to hard limits to keep CI storage predictable. When customers report failed uploads or truncated diffs, check whether they've exceeded the per-project snapshot quota before escalating to the Renlow build team. The enforced limits, as configured in the current release, are shown below.

tuning table, yajog-yahof:
BUDGETS = {
    "lamvan": 303,
    "wenox": 460,
    "fenvan": 525,
}

## Replica Lag Alarm — Ternbrook Reads DB

Heads-up: this alarm fires when the Ternbrook read replica falls more than 45 seconds behind primary. Usual suspects are bulk imports from the Harvestly job or a long-running analytics query hogging the replica. First move: check the replication thread status and kill any runaway query. Escalate if lag exceeds five minutes, since stale reads can leak into the consent dashboard. The alarm thresholds and connection settings currently in effect are listed below.

deployment values, yafop-tahof:
HOLIX_HOST=holix.zemvarsys.internal
HOLIX_PORT=3306

CI Troubleshooting: DiffHarbor large-file viewer

If the render job for files over 50 MB times out on the Quillbrook runners, don't retry blindly. First check that the chunked-diff flag is enabled in the pipeline config; without it, DiffHarbor loads the whole file into memory and the runner gets OOM-killed. Second, confirm the artifact cache was warmed by the previous stage. If both look right, grab the failing stage's token before escalating to the platform team. The token appears directly below this note.

pipeline stamp: htk4_b7f3

Release checklist — Pairwell matching service: confirm the GC tuning change actually holds under load. We switched to the low-pause collector after the 1.2s stop-the-world pauses were timing out match handshakes, which, heads up, also tripped some auth retries you'll want to eyeball for replay weirdness. Soak test ran clean for six hours, max pause 40ms. From a security angle, nothing in the retry path logs tokens anymore. Validate your review against the build stamped below.

build token for kagaf-hahof: htk14_9d3d4d26d7d8de